In an international film festival, a penal of 11 judges is formed to judge the best film. At last two films FA and FB were considered to be the best where the opinion of judges got divided. Six judges where in favor of FA whereas five in favor of FB. A random sample of five judges was drawn from the panel. Find the probability that out of five judges, three are in favor of film FA.
Answer:
The answer is "0.4329 ".
Step-by-step explanation:
P( three in favor of FA)
Select 3 out of 6 FA supporters then select 2 out of 5 FB supportive judges
\(=\frac{^{6}_{C_{3}}\times ^{5}_{C_{2}}}{^{11}_{C_{5}}}\\\\=\frac{\frac{6!}{3!(6-3)!}\times \frac{5!}{2!(5-2)!}}{\frac{11!}{5!(11-5)!}}\\\\=\frac{\frac{6!}{3! \times 3!}\times \frac{5!}{2! \times 3!}}{\frac{11!}{5! \times 6!}}\\\\=\frac{\frac{6 \times 5 \times 4 \times 3!}{3 \times 2 \times 1\times 3!}\times \frac{5 \times 4 \times 3!}{2 \times 1 \times 3!}}{\frac{11 \times10 \times 9 \times 8 \times 7 \times 6! }{5 \times 4 \times 3 \times 2 \times 1 \times 6!}}\\\\\)
\(=\frac{ (5 \times 4) \times(5 \times 2)}{(11 \times 3 \times 2 \times 7 )}\\\\=\frac{ 20 \times 10 }{(11 \times 42)}\\\\=\frac{ 200 }{462}\\\\=\frac{100 }{231}\\\\=0.4329\)

A commuter plane provides transportation from an international airport to surrounding cities. One commuter plane averaged 260 mph flying to a city and 140 mph returning to the international airport. The total flying time was 4 h. Find the distance between the two airports.
Answer:
364 miles
Step-by-step explanation:
Rate Time Distance
Flight #1 260 x 260x
Flight #2 140 4-x 140(4-x)
Because each flight was to or from the same airports the distance traveled by flight #1 and flight #2 must be the same. This means that you can set the two calculated distances equal to each other.
260x = 140(4-x)
260x = 560 - 140x
400x = 560
x = 1.4 hours This is the amount of time flight 1 spent in the air.
now we can use this and plug it into the distance formula (260x) to find the distance
260(1.4) = 364
so the distance between the two airports is 364 miles

Find the third iterate x3 of f(x) = 2x + 3
for an initial value of x0 = 2
a. 7
b. 15
c. 17
d. 37
For the function f(x) = 2x + 3 the third iterate x₃ is 37
To find the third iterate, x3, of the function f(x) = 2x + 3, given an initial value of x₀ = 2,
we can apply the function repeatedly.
Starting with x₀ = 2:
x₁ = f(x₀)
= 2(2) + 3
= 7
x₂ = f(x₁)
= 2(7) + 3 = 17
x₃ = f(x₂)
= 2(17) + 3
= 37
Therefore, the third iterate x₃ is 37.
